The musical "The Lion King" will raise funds for the Raquel Payà school

May 03 from 2016 - 12: 54

To the beat of Hakuna Matata special education school Raquel Payà will benefit from a new charity event this weekend. Thanks to the collaboration of the dance school and Cuqui Ivars County Chamber, the representation of the musical El Rey León will raise funds for the school.

This activity, organized by the Association of Mothers and Fathers of the School will take place this Saturday 7 of May at 18 hours in the Condado room and will have the participation of all the students of the Cuqui Ivars school. The collection of tickets, which have already been used up, will go towards the purchase of material and the start-up of new extracurricular activities for the students of the center.

Musical The Lion King for Raquel Payà

The idea came from a mother school, Marisa, who contacted both the school and with the room to explore possibilities for cooperation existed. The arrangement for both parties was immediate and began work on the dissemination of the event. The room went on sale the 370 locations available at a price of 12 euros, and sold out within days.

From the hall County celebrate they have gone in search of support from school because they will transfer for free room for both function and for the necessary tests. Diana Cervera acknowledged that it has been very easy to work with them and was willing to collaborate more initiatives soon. Cervera psoitivamente valued very educational techniques used at the school, which branded the "example to follow" for the rest of schools.

Due to the rapid sale of tickets for the show of solidarity, the room has reprogrammed the music for Sunday May 8, also at 17 hours, so that those who have not gotten tickets to enjoy it. In this case, the collection will not be beneficial.

Family morning yoga

The activities do not stop at the center, and this May AMPA programming includes a morning yoga open to all students at the school and other schools in the county family. It will be on Saturday May 21 in school and will help us understand how students respond to an unknown practice so far for most such as yoga.

Prom Party

21 next June, the center will hold its traditional end of year party, which this year will become a film festival, as each classroom is working on different audiovisual pieces that will be shown that day.

In addition the center will take the opportunity to celebrate an act of gratitude to all individuals and organizations that have collaborated with them during this year.
